What sizes of restroom trailers are available?

Brentwood Porta Pros carries 2 stall, 4 stall and 8 stall restroom trailers, plus a separate shower trailer rental for multi-day events or disaster response work. A 2 stall unit suits a backyard wedding or a small home renovation crew, while a 4 stall trailer handles a mid-size company picnic or a golf tournament turn. The 8 stall option covers festival grounds or a marathon finish line where lines build fast. Each step up adds fixtures, not just floor space, so a 2 station restroom trailer rental cost sits well below what an 8 stall unit runs for the same weekend. Why choose a restroom trailer over a standard porta potty?

A trailer buys you flushing toilets, running water and an enclosed, climate-controlled space, not just a stall with a door. Guests at a wedding or corporate event expect something closer to indoor plumbing, and a standard porta potty rental rarely delivers that impression even when it is clean and well stocked. A restroom trailer also handles more traffic per hour without the line backing up, which matters for anything modeled on OSHA 1926.51(c) worker ratios or a busy event schedule. Where can a restroom trailer be placed on a Brentwood property?

Placement depends on ground stability and clearance for delivery. ADA Standards section 302.1 calls for floor and ground surfaces that are stable, firm and slip resistant, which rules out soft lawn or loose gravel for trailer leveling. A roll-off style delivery for a trailer needs roughly 60 feet of straight clearance behind the truck, the same clearance a roll-off dumpster rental delivery requires, so measure your driveway or access road before booking. If the trailer sits near a public sidewalk or roadway in Brentwood, placement in the right of way needs confirming with the city; we have not verified a specific ordinance number for that here, so ask before you finalize a spot. For ramps into the trailer, ADA Standards section 405.2 caps running slope at 1:12, and the accessible route itself needs a 36 inch minimum clear width under ADA Standards section 403.5.1. Is a restroom trailer ADA accessible?

Not every restroom trailer includes an accessible stall by default, so ask when you book if your event needs one. Where several single-user portable units are clustered, ADA Standards section 213.2 requires at least 5 percent to be accessible units, with a minimum of one regardless of total count. An accessible stall needs a 32 inch minimum clear door opening under ADA Standards section 404.2.3 and a 60 inch turning circle inside per ADA Standards section 304.3.1. Reach ranges for soap and paper dispensers fall under ADA Standards section 308.2.1, capped at 48 inches high and 15 inches low, and door hardware must work with one hand under 5 pounds of force per ADA Standards section 309.4. Do restroom trailers need power and water hookups?

Most restroom trailers run on a standard exterior outlet or a small generator, and larger luxury units may call for more amperage depending on lighting, climate control and pump load. OSHA 1926.51(a)(1) requires an adequate supply of potable water at any place of employment, which is why Brentwood Porta Pros connects trailers to a water source or supplies a self-contained tank on delivery. If your site lacks nearby power, a light tower rental or temporary power pole can cover both lighting and trailer power needs on the same job. Washing facilities must include soap and towels or a hand-drying device under 29 CFR 1910.141(d)(2); hand sanitizer alone does not meet that standard, so every trailer we deliver comes stocked accordingly. Sites running paint, coatings or pesticide work also trigger OSHA 1926.51(f)(1) washing requirements, which a trailer's sink setup satisfies without adding a separate handwashing station rental, though many jobsites still add one near the work zone for convenience.

How many stalls do I need for my event?

It depends on guest count and event length; a 2 stall trailer suits under 75 guests for a few hours, while 150 or more guests over a full day points toward a 4 or 8 stall unit. The how many porta potties do I need guide walks through the math step by step.

What is the difference between a luxury and standard restroom trailer?

A luxury restroom trailer adds finished interiors, climate control and often multiple sink stations, while a standard trailer covers the same fixture count with simpler finishes.
